
The Union of All Ceylon School Development Officers this week began a protest campaign at the Fort Railway Station in Colombo, calling for their recruitment as teachers, considering they have been teaching in rural and estate schools for the previous six years.
The protest was initiated in front of the president’s office last Monday to launch the protest campaign outside the railway station. Teachers from several provinces have been taking turns in the protest. and they stated that they anticipated a solution with the upcoming budget.
